The MKDSN 2.5 series of pc board terminal blocks are only 15 mm high and accept 12 AWG wire. The bodies are nickel or tin plated copper alloy for demanding environments, and an interlock housing allows any number of positions to be assembled while maintaining a 5.08 mm pin spacing. Current carrying capacity is 10A at 300V.
